Chicago State University is Illinois only four-year U.S. Department of Education-designated Predominantly Black Institution PBI. CSU serves over 1500 undergraduate students and nearly 900 graduate students. The university is a nationally accredited university with five colleges in Arts and Sciences Business Education Health Sciences and Pharmacy and proudly supports a diverse and non-traditional student population that hails from 28 countries and 36 states.Discover the latest advancements and milestones achieved by CSU in our Annual Report httpswww.csu.edupresidentannual_report.htm.All faculty positions are governed by the tenets of a collective bargaining agreement.
